Canucks Ready For Do or Die?

Ready for tonight's game 7? Don't read Iain Macintyre in the Sun:

"Vancouver has lost its last two Game 7s, both at home. Eight Canucks remain from the 2003 team that smoked the exhaust pipe after leading Minnesota 3-1 in games. The Canucks have lost six straight playoff games when they had a chance to advance from a series, and are 2-8 at home since the first game of the Minnesota playoff. No National Hockey League team has ever been shut out four times in a seven-game series. No team has ever scored fewer than nine goals in a seven-game series.

And on it goes, layers of blackness deep enough to suffocate them."

Comforting, yes?
